Review: American Gun

When I first found out about the movie the first thing I read was that it was the same style as the movie Crash (not David Cronenbergs CRASH). The movie talks about guns in America and their effects on people and since Crash was a good movie I was looking forward to watching American Gun.
I watched the movie last night and the best thing about the movie is Donald Sutherland. If you use a bit of your imagination and squint your eyes a bit you could pretend Donald Sutherland was Jack Bauer pretending to be an old guy trying to infiltrate a terrorist group. Thats the only thing that kept me going till the end of the movie. It started off slow but I was cool with that, nothing happened in the middle, I was cool with that too, but then the movie finished and nothing had happened. I was expecting for all the different stories in the movie to interweave for a big final but they didn’t. From the couple of stories that were taking place only one of them had something happen. It was extremely disappointing since they build you up for nothing.
I wouldn’t recommend anyone watch this movie, and I am scoring it a 2 out of 5. I would have given it a 1 but because Donald Sutherland had a role in bringing Jack Bauer to life he gets an extra star.
